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)-
TL;DR: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)- (CAS 145131-48-2) is a chemical compound with molecular formula C25H31N3O4 and molecular weight 437.23 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
1-[[1-(1-methylindol-3-yl)cyclopentyl]methyl]-3-(2,4,6-trimethoxyphenyl)urea
Also Known As: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)-, N-((1-(1-Meth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)urea, N(sup 1)-(2,4,6-Trimethoxyphenyl)-N(sup 2)-(1-(1-methyl-3-indolyl)cyclopentylmethyl)urea, 1-[[1-(1-methylindol-3-yl)cyclopentyl]methyl]-3-(2,4,6-trimethoxyphenyl)urea, N-{[1-(1-Methyl-1H-indol-3-yl)cyclopentyl]methyl}-N'-(2,4,6-trimethoxyphenyl)urea
| Molecular Formula | C25H31N3O4 |
|---|---|
| Molecular Weight | 437.23 g/mol |
| LogP | 4.8376 |
| Topological Polar Surface Area | 73.75 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 4 |
| Rotatable Bonds | 7 |
| Exact Mass | 437.23145 |
| Heavy Atoms | 32 |
| Complexity | 1090.5676 |
Chemical Identifiers
| CAS Number | 145131-48-2 |
|---|---|
| SMILES | CN1C=C(C2=CC=CC=C21)C3(CCCC3)CNC(=O)NC4=C(C=C(C=C4OC)OC)OC |

Chemical Property Profile of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)-
Property Insights of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)-
The XLogP value of 4.8376 indicates that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)- is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 73.75 Ų falls within the moderate polarity range, balancing permeability and solubility for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)-. Following Lipinski's Rule of Five, Urea, N-((1-(1-methyl-1H-indol-3-yl)cyclopentyl)methyl)-N'-(2,4,6-trimethoxyphenyl)- has 2 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
